본문 Sensitivity Analysis is a process whereby
the soundness or robustness of the results and conclusions of economic
evaluations are tested by varying the underlying assumptions and variables over
a range of plausible values
Purpose of Sensitivity Analysis
Used
to determine the effect of data uncertainty, or assumptions, on study
conclusions
Used to identify the most important study
assumptions
Situation when Sensitivity Analysis should be
used
1)Data elements are uncertain because no figures are
available and estimates must be used 2)Data elements are not
precise 3)Data elements are unknown because of pharmacoeconomic
methodology controversies
